Formula......See Question #3 6. ALL INCLUSIVE PROBLEM..........10 POINTS You are the new department manager at TOMMY'S.TOY SHOP. When you took over the department you had a retail inventory of $42,000 that cost $28,000. During your first month you purchased an additional $19,000 that you priced into retail at $30,000. Net sales for the first month were $38,000. CALCULATE: A. TOTAL MERCHANDISE HANDLED AT RETAIL B. TOTAL MERCHANDISE HANDLED AT COST c. CUMULATIVE MARKUP PERCENTAGE D. ENDING INVENTORY AT RETAIL E. ENDING INVENTORY AT COST F. COST OF GOODS SOLD GROSS G. GROSS MARGIN DOLLARS H. STOCK TURNOVER FOR THE MONTH Formulas that are helpful: Markup%-Retail - Cost/Retail Retail = Cost/1- Mu% Cost = Retail x (1- Mu%) Sales - Cost of Goods Sold - Gross Margin Cost of Goods Sold = Beginning Inventory + Purchases - Ending Inventory Turnover =Sales/Average Inventory at Retail
